Education Council (EdCo) is an internal governance body of Selkirk College—required by the College and Institute Act —that considers educational policies about planning, operations, evaluation and standards. EdCo advises the Selkirk College Board of Governors on approving, evaluating, suspending and cancelling programs and courses and implementing new programs and courses. EdCo approves curriculum

EdCo has 21 voting members, representing students, employees and leadership. Learn how you can take part ! All members serve a two-year term with the exception of students who serve a one-year term.
